R. K. Cho business award
The R. K. Cho Economics Award ( Korean : 조 락교 경제학 상) is an award given by Yonsei University in the field of economics . The award was endowed in 2007 by means of an endowment by RK Cho, the managing director of the packaging company Samryoong , and is intended to honor outstanding achievements in the field of economics. Originally intended exclusively for South Korean award winners, this restriction in the award criteria was later lifted. The prize money is 100 million South Korean won .
Previous winners
- 2008: Yeon-Koo Che ( Columbia University )
- 2009: Hyun-Song Shin ( Princeton University )
- 2010: Joon Y. Park ( Indiana University Bloomington )
- 2011: Jinyong Hahn ( University of California, Los Angeles )
- 2012: In-koo Cho ( University of Illinois )
- 2013: Chang Yongsung (Yonsei University)
- 2014: Choi Jae-pil (Yonsei University)
- 2015: Richard Rogerson ( Princeton University )
- 2016: Quang Vuong ( New York University )
- 2017: Michihiro Kandori ( University of Tokyo )
- 2018: Hyungsik Roger Moon ( University of Southern California )
- 2020: Valerie Ramey ( University of California, San Diego )
